About Akiko Yosano

Akiko Yosano, born on December 7th, 1878 in Japan, was a renowned and controversial Japanese poet, writer, feminist, and pacifist who authored between 20,000 to 50,000 poems. She is perhaps best known for her anti-war poem titled “Kimi Shinitamou koto nakare,” which was published during the Russo-Japanese War.

Prior to gaining fame as a poet and writer, Yosano managed her family’s candy business from a young age of eleven. Her birth name was Sho Ho; Akiko Yosano served as her pen name. In 1901 she married literary editor Tekkan Yosano with whom she had thirteen children.
